What are people's opinions on roleplay preceding combat? Do you think there is some minimum standard that should be met before you move straight to the red text mechanics?
There's almost always some roleplay preceding premeditated combat, whether the victim happens to be aware of the connection between the two events is another question.

In terms of the literal moments before attack commands go out, roleplay may be possible or even highly desirable in some circumstances but is wildly impractical in others, when merely getting the attack commands themselves fired off quickly enough can be tight timing. So as usual my opinion is that any hard requirement is not compatible with the combat system and the best option is to foster softer encouragement about roleplaying during less time constrained moments.

This makes sense for situations like chasing someone who is actively fleeing you and such, but I feel like situations where there's ample time to do some RP before just typing 'attack', there should be RP done.
Maybe my preferences here are wildly different. I've played a lot of games where code = RP. So that red text that says another character is hitting you? That is still roleplay - everyone is obviously still IC, the same as if you were to pose that fight.
I just want to point a few things out:

If you just wait until the other character tries to flee, you will very frequently lose your chance to attack at all and the fleeing tends to be a much greater hamper to the emoting, dialoging right then and there RP I think this thread is talking about.

As others said... RP does happen surrounding the attack. Your likely had RP character caught the attention of others. Maybe another player had RP where they paid your attacker or manipulated them so they wanted to attack your PC. Maybe the player of the attacker had a bunch of RP gathering information about your PC. Your PC will have the RP after the attack of dealing with it's fallout.

That's excluding the fact that, as Leech said, the punches and kicks and gunshots are RP in and of themselves. I fully agree with this. Often, I see players have their characters dialog and emote during the RP of the attack. Enriching it further. They don't have to do that and it can truly backfire on them when they do.

I'm not trying to entirely dismiss Leudo's suggestion though. I just don't think it's all about the dialog and posing done right before the 'attack' command is used. I think it extends out further. The fact is that the silent murder or noisy disfigurement with no message before or after is easier and quicker. They may be however, in my opinion, some of the least effective moves possible. At the same time I also know that the other, arguably more effective, options by necessity stretch things out and involve more effort.

I'd love to see more variety. More arguing and back and forth. More messaging and... More of it all. But I understand why people often take the simple and well used methods. I'll take them over nothing at all any day!
